Simplifying Data Change Tracking with InterBase Change Views

By Stephen Ball, EMEA Technical Sales Consultant (RAD) & Associate Product Manager (InterBase)

The new InterBase® patent pending feature “Change Views” introduces a new approach to tracking data changes (with field level granularity) in server as well as personal computer/tablet/mobile databases. It is designed for today’s mobile centric world.

API Guide

The API Guide provides information on developing InterBase applications using the InterBase API interface; programming with the InterBase API; working with databases, transactions, dynamic SQL, blob data, arrays, conversions, and service; installing/licensing APIs; exporting XML; handling error conditions; and the InterBase API function reference.

Data Definition Guide

The Data Definition Guide covers how to design and build InterBase databases including: specifying datatypes; working with domains, tables, and indexes; working with procedures, triggers, and generators; encrypting databases and columns; and character sets and collation orders.

Developer's Guide

The Developer’s Guide includes information on how to develop InterBase database applications using Embarcadero development tools, JDBC, and ODBC including: connecting to databases; understanding datasets; working with tables, queries, stored procedures, cached updated and events; working with UDF and Blob filters; importing and exporting data; working with InterBase Services; and writing install wizards.

Embedded SQL Guide

The Embedded SQL Guide gives instructions on developing InterBase applications using embedded SQL including: application requirements, working with databases, transactions, data definition statements, data, dates and times, arrays, stored procedures and events; error handling; dynamic SQL; and preprocessing, compiling, and linking.

Language Reference

The Language Reference Guide discusses each of the InterBase elements including: the SQL statement and function reference; procedures and triggers; keywords; error codes and messages; system tables, temporary tables, and views; and character sets and collation orders.

Operations Guide

The Operations Guide gives detailed instructions on working with InterBase databases including: using IBConsole; configuring and operating the InterBase server; network configuration; performing backups and restores; using journaling and journal archiving; database security; and interactive queries.
